Cheryl Canfield, CHT, is a wellness and life counselor, teacher of spiritual principles, author, therapeutic yoga instructor, peace proponent (inner as well as outer), and nationally known inspirational speaker and workshop leader. She is now seeing clients in Copperopolis, as well as Santa Rosa, CA. She is the author of Profound Healing: The Power of Acceptance on the Path to Wellness, a down-to-earth account of her journey as she confronts a diagnosis of advanced cancer at the age of 41. Going against proposed radical surgeries, she focused her attention on attempting to come to a place of inner peace before dying. In the process she inadvertently experienced a miracle and became well. Her subsequent reflections on physical, emotional and spiritual healing are summarized into twelve self-help practices so that others may use her hard-earned insights as a source of hope, inspiration, and practical advice. Current President of Friends of Peace Pilgrim, a non-profit organization, she is co-compiler of Peace Pilgrim: Her Life and Work in Her Own Words, a spiritual classic with over 500,000 copies in print, and compiler and editor of Peace Pilgrim's Wisdom, an inspiring collection of seed thoughts from Peace's lectures and writings. Co-founder: Randal Churchill
Randal Churchill, CHT, is founder of the Hypnotherapy Training Institute in Northern California, one of the first licensed hypnotherapy schools in 1978. He has received international acclaim for his creative and comprehensive therapy and teaching skills. He is author of Become the Dream: The Transforming Power of Hypnotic Dreamwork, a book that describes his work as originator of hypnotic dreamwork and Regression Hypnotherapy: Transcrips of Transformation, called the most important book about regression ever published. Both books have received the Founders Award for Excellence in professional literature.
